Golden State Warriors: The Dynasty's Legacy

Let's start with a team that's synonymous with long-range wizardry: the Golden State Warriors. These guys, with their core of Stephen Curry, Klay Thompson, and others, have been a force to be reckoned with. Their dynasty wasn't just built on talent; it was built on a revolution in how the game is played. They understood that the three-point shot wasn't just a shot; it was a weapon. They maximized their three-point attempts with their motion offense, which creates open looks for their deadly shooters. Curry's unbelievable shooting is at the forefront of this team. His ability to hit shots from anywhere on the court made him one of the best shooters ever. Klay Thompson, known for his ability to hit shots in bunches, also contributed to the Warriors' perimeter shooting prowess. The Warriors didn't just shoot threes; they were masters of creating space, moving the ball, and finding the perfect shot. They've changed the NBA, and their legacy as one of the best three-point shooting teams of all time is well and truly cemented. The constant movement and ball-handling skills of players like Curry and Thompson create opportunities, while also being capable of hitting shots with tight defense. The Warriors have mastered the art of the three-point shot, making them a force to be reckoned with.

Milwaukee Bucks: Giannis and the Long Ball

Now, let's talk about the Milwaukee Bucks. This is a team that's been on the rise. With a team that revolves around Giannis Antetokounmpo, one might not immediately think of a three-point-dominant team. However, the Bucks have strategically incorporated the long ball into their game, allowing them to complement Giannis's powerful inside presence. This combination of interior dominance and perimeter shooting creates a balanced and dangerous offensive attack. The strategy they implement has made them a team that’s difficult to predict and defend. The ability of the Bucks' role players to step up and knock down three-pointers has been crucial in creating space for Giannis to operate and in keeping opponents guessing. The Bucks have proved that you can succeed by combining multiple offensive strategies. Their focus on improving their outside shooting has paid dividends, allowing them to compete at the highest level. The Milwaukee Bucks have become a force in the league. With a combination of a dominant inside presence and improved three-point shooting, they have become a team to be feared. This strategic shift in their offensive game plan demonstrates the evolution of the NBA and the increasing importance of the three-point shot.

The Impact of the Three-Point Revolution

The three-point shot has dramatically changed the NBA, influencing not only how teams score but also how they build their rosters and develop players. The emphasis on spacing, player movement, and shot selection has become essential. Teams are increasingly looking for players who can shoot, regardless of their size or position. This shift has led to more high-scoring games, more excitement, and a new understanding of what it takes to win in the modern NBA. Now, many teams use analytics to assess their shot selection and optimize their offensive strategies. The three-point shot has made the game more exciting, and more strategic, and has redefined the requirements for success in the NBA. The three-point revolution isn't just about more points; it's about a complete re-imagining of how basketball is played.
